DIRECTOR OF PUBLIC PROSECUTIONS ACT 1990 - SECT 10

Appeals

    (1)     The director may, in respect of a prosecution or proceedings conducted by the director, exercise such rights of appeal (if any)—

        (a)     as are exercisable by the Attorney-General; or

        (b)     in the case of a prosecution or proceedings the conduct of which the director has taken over from a person other than the Attorney-General—as would have been exercisable by that person if the director had not taken over the conduct of the prosecution or proceedings.

    (2)     The rights of appeal conferred on the director under subsection (1) are in additional to such rights of appeal (if any) as are exercisable by the director otherwise than under that subsection.

    (3)     In this section:

"right of appeal" includes—

        (a)     a right to apply for a review or rehearing; and

        (b)     a right to institute proceedings in the nature of an appeal or of an application for a review or rehearing; and

        (c)     a right to appeal against sentence.
